Aarav does not mean to break the marigold chosen for the visitor table. He only steps back, laughs too quickly and says sorry before he truly understands what has happened. But the broken plant leads to a cracked pot, a hurt friend, a class rumour and a garden bed that cannot be repaired with one hurried word.
With Meera, Kabir and Zoya beside him, Aarav learns that an apology is more than saying sorry. It means naming the harm, listening carefully, helping with the real repair and showing through future actions that trust matters.
The Sorry Garden is a warm school-based chapter book for readers ages 7-11 about apologies, responsibility, empathy, forgiveness, repair and growing kindness after mistakes.
